2. Always Verify Authenticity
Because Rolex is such a coveted brand, it is also one of the most counterfeited luxury watch brands in the world. The market is flooded with fakes—some are obvious knock-offs, while others (known as “super fakes”) can be nearly impossible to detect without expertise.
That’s why it’s crucial to buy from a reputable and trustworthy source—like On Demand Luxe, where every watch is authenticated and verified before being offered for sale.
In the meantime, here are a few tips to help you spot a genuine Rolex:
-
Check the weight: Real Rolex watches are made with high-quality metals and feel noticeably heavier.
-
Inspect the dial: Look closely at the text on the dial. It should be perfectly crisp and evenly spaced. Any blurriness or misalignment is a red flag.
-
Serial and reference numbers: These are engraved between the lugs of the case. Compare them with official Rolex records to make sure the parts and design match the model.
-
Smooth movement: Rolex watches use mechanical movements, which give a smooth, sweeping motion to the second hand—not the ticking motion found in quartz replicas.
For complete confidence, it's best to have the watch authenticated by professionals before finalizing the purchase.
3. Pick a Rolex That Matches Your Personal Style
One of the best things about Rolex is the wide variety of models and styles available. Whether your taste leans toward sleek and simple or bold and sporty, there's a Rolex for every personality.
Owning a Rolex isn’t just about status—it’s about expressing who you are. Ask yourself:
-
Do you need a watch for everyday use?
-
Do you attend formal events often?
-
Do you want a bold conversation starter or something more subtle?
For example:
-
The Submariner is perfect for those with an adventurous lifestyle. Originally designed for divers, it’s sporty, durable, and water-resistant.
-
The Datejust is a classic choice for professionals. With its clean look and versatile design, it transitions easily from office wear to evening events.
-
The Day-Date, also known as the “President,” is a bold, elegant statement piece often seen on influential leaders.
-
The Explorer or Air-King offers minimalist styling with a rugged edge, great for casual wearers or travelers.
Ultimately, the best Rolex for you is the one that fits your lifestyle and feels right on your wrist.
4. Learn How to Care for and Maintain Your Rolex
Rolex watches are built for a lifetime of use—but like any fine machine, they require proper care and regular maintenance. With the right attention, your Rolex will not only look stunning but perform flawlessly for generations.
Here are a few tips to keep your watch in top condition:
-
Regular servicing: Experts recommend servicing your Rolex every 3 to 5 years. This includes cleaning the movement, lubricating parts, and checking for water resistance.
-
Avoid extreme environments: Even though Rolex watches are durable, extreme temperatures or magnetic fields can impact performance.
-
Clean your watch gently: Use a soft cloth and mild soapy water (if the watch is waterproof) to clean off dirt and sweat. Rinse and dry thoroughly.
-
Store it safely: When not wearing your Rolex, store it in a watch box or soft pouch to protect it from scratches or dust.
Neglecting maintenance can lead to issues down the line—like water damage, reduced accuracy, or premature wear. Taking simple steps to care for your Rolex will protect both its function and its long-term value.
